SAS用语句导入CSV文件的步骤

2025-10-26 04:22:10

1、我们以一个数据有缺失的CSV文件为例子

SAS用语句导入CSV文件的步骤

2、      Infile语句选择相应的文件,DLM=', ' : 语句选择数据间的分级符号为逗号,可以选择其他符号

      DSD有三个作用:忽略引号中数据的分隔符并去除引号;非引号中的逗号能识别成分隔符;将两个相邻的分隔符当作缺失值来处理

      MISSOVER : 在input语句中输入的几个变量,SAS在观测值中就读取几个变量,如果一行未读完,用缺失值填补满进下一行

SAS用语句导入CSV文件的步骤

SAS用语句导入CSV文件的步骤

1、相同的CSV文件,不同是第一行多了变量名

SAS用语句导入CSV文件的步骤

2、         Proc import会自动识别第一行为变量名,可以通过在Proc import后面增加Getnames=NO语句来改变这种默认,PROC IMPORT会分配给变量名字:VAR1,VAR2,VAR3等

         Replace如果想要创建的数据集名字已经存在,那么要用replace选项代替

SAS用语句导入CSV文件的步骤

SAS用语句导入CSV文件的步骤

3、Proc import也可以读取下面的类型的文件

SAS用语句导入CSV文件的步骤

声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
猜你喜欢